Abstract
The present invention provides a new NAD(P)-independent glycerol dehydrogenase and a process for obtaining it, wherein a micro-organism of the species Pseudomonas, Serratia, Klebsiella, Erwinia, Aspergillus, Penicillium, Rhizopus, Acetobacter or Gluconobacter which is capable of forming this enzyme is cultured in a nutrient medium and the enzyme isolated from the culture broth. The present invention also provides processes for the determination of glycerol and of triglycerides which make use of this new enzyme.
